Does Annual Leave Count Towards Fmla? FMLA only requires unpaid leave, but employees can elect to use accrued paid vacation, sick, or family leave for some or all of the FMLA leave period if they choose to do so. FMLA-protected leave is available when it is used for a FMLA-covered reason.

The Family and Medical Leave Act (FMLA) provides eligible employees up to 12 workweeks of unpaid leave a year, and requires group health benefits to be maintained during the leave as if employees continued to work instead of taking leave. Employees are also entitled to return to their same or an equivalent job at the end of their FMLA leave.

CALCULATION OF LEAVE USAGE Only the amount of leave actually taken may be counted against an employee's FMLA leave entitlement. Where an employee takes FMLA leave for less than a full workweek, the amount of FMLA leave used is determined as a proportion of the employee's actual workweek.

Hours of Service Requirement (Q) Does the time I take off for vacation, sick leave or PTO count toward the 1,250 hours? The 1,250 hours include only those hours actually worked for the employer. Paid leave and unpaid leave, including FMLA leave, are not included. ( Special hours of service rules apply to airline flight crew members. ) Unpaid leave

In a situation where it is physically impossible for an employee using intermittent leave or working a reduced leave schedule to begin or end work mid-way through a shift, the entire period the employee must be absent is designated as FMLA-protected leave and counts against the employee's FMLA entitlement.
